Magento SEO for Plymouth retailers, where the same product is commonly reachable at several different addresses. Products assigned to multiple categories can generate a URL under each, so one item exists as three or four pages competing with one another — and the rewrite table quietly grows to hundreds of thousands of rows.

What we deliver
- Category paths in product URLs settled, since this is what creates the duplication
- Canonical tags configured for products, categories and paginated listings
- URL rewrite table examined, as it grows and accumulates stale entries
- Layered navigation controlled so filter combinations are not crawled
- Store views handled correctly where multiple languages or regions exist
- Structured data verified rather than assumed correct from the theme

- Why does one product have several URLs?
- Because Magento can include the category path. A product in four categories then has four addresses showing identical content, which divides whatever authority the page has earned and gives search engines no reason to prefer any particular one.
- What should the URL structure be?
- Usually products at a single path without the category. It keeps each product to one address, survives recategorisation without generating redirects, and removes the whole class of duplication — at the cost of URLs that carry less descriptive context.
- Why does the rewrite table matter?
- Because it grows and slows things down. Every product and category change adds entries, and on a large catalogue the table can reach a size where it affects performance as well as holding rewrites for things that no longer exist.
- How are store views handled?
- With correct language annotations and separate canonical handling per view. Multi-store Magento estates frequently have several store views serving near-identical content, and without the right markup they compete with one another rather than each serving their own market.
